Understanding The Basics: How Roku TV Functions As A Streaming Device

Roku TV has become a popular choice for streaming enthusiasts due to its user-friendly interface and extensive content library. As a streaming device, it connects to the internet and allows users to access various streaming platforms, such as Netflix, Hulu, and Amazon Prime Video, directly on their television screens.

The functionality of Roku TV revolves around its operating system, known as the Roku OS. This OS enables users to navigate through various streaming channels, search for specific content, and control the device using either a physical remote or a mobile app.

Roku TV utilizes an intuitive grid-like interface that displays different streaming channels and apps. Users can customize their home screen by rearranging channel placements according to their preferences. Additionally, Roku TV features a universal search function which allows users to search for movies, TV shows, actors, and directors across multiple streaming platforms, simplifying the content discovery process.

In terms of hardware, Roku TV typically consists of an HDMI connection, Ethernet port, built-in Wi-Fi, and USB ports for connecting external devices. Some models may also have additional features like voice control or gaming capabilities.

Alternative Methods: Exploring Alternative Ways To Power On And Off Roku TV

Roku TVs are known for their simple and convenient power button located on the device itself. However, there are alternative methods available to power on and off your Roku TV that you may find useful.

One alternative method is to use the Roku mobile app. By downloading the app on your smartphone or tablet, you can control your Roku TV remotely. The app provides a virtual power button, allowing you to turn your Roku TV on or off with just a tap on your phone screen.

Another alternative method is to enable HDMI-CEC (Consumer Electronics Control). This feature allows you to control multiple devices with a single remote control. By enabling HDMI-CEC on your Roku TV and other HDMI-connected devices, you can use the power button on your TV remote to power on and off all compatible devices simultaneously.

Furthermore, if your Roku TV supports voice control, you can utilize voice commands to power on and off your TV. Simply use the voice control feature on your Roku remote and say “power on” or “power off” to turn your Roku TV on or off.

These alternative methods provide additional convenience and flexibility in powering on and off your Roku TV, enhancing your overall streaming experience.
